Before Shell sold its Hengyuan assets, and more recently, Bukom assets, refueling with Shell was actually more desirable because being Shell they didnt like being in non-compliance so the fuels they refined and produced would usually be a certain % above the RON95 octane spec just in case, perhaps higher than the green dudes. But today the source for ur petrol is essentially coming from the same place as petronas for all petrol in msia (melaka, pengerang) apart from the detergents.

Anyway what i can share for 17-18 models: Bought from dealer (Regas Premium). At the time they offered a 5+1 year deal. Funnily enough the battery problems really came just as the warranty was about to expire. Phew! (Air suspension not so lucky, 20k iirc.. ouch)

As for Covered Components under respective plans, its in the fine print can find out here: https://www.bmw.com.my/en/topics/bmw-owners/bmw-financial-services/insurance/extended-warranty.html

Warranty experience: If the part memang ada issue, no problem getting under warranty. For “neutral” components (eg early wear and tear), it used to be quite “straightforward” with the dealer, they can try to wiggle round the policy to get it sorted for u covered. More recently I think BMW HQ start to crackdown and the warranty process is much stricter and more tedious (ie harder to get away with neutral claims). Really depends on how the dealer fight for you so cant say for all.

But all in all just get the longest warranty u can for peace of mind. Not unless u like to be a bit more involved and source your own oem parts and form a good relationship with a mechanic… but thats another topic altogether 🫢. (Welcome to end of warranty bmw life)

Annual maintenance ~ 3k Full maintenance ~ 5k (Covered by warranty/service package. Not including additional scopes. Next year will be funding out of pocket)

Emergency funds… Runflats 1.8-2k+ range per tyre? Maybe prepare 10-20k for wear and tear upkeep etc down the road (not immediately incurred but along the way. but not of concern yet since u got warranty)

BMW X5 xDrive45e - Consideration by Mission-Ad-4841 in kereta

[–]aaroncch 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Family has two. Both clocking about 100k mileage each.

What I can add is, be prepared for when the battery fails and needs repair. Warranty can save u… but after it expires really down to time. Air suspension also goes with time. The rest is just wear and tear items like bushings etc on the suspension components (can get annoying).

Heard stories of the gearbox dying on other X5s… I guess its something to do with when the petrol engine kicks in at speed and the onboard computer failed to sync properly, the gearbox took a hit. Smtg like that.

Otherwise a very good everyday car. Can take beating too. Long distance, short trips, it can do it all. Good blend of petrol and ev for the typical person. Fuel economy is great. Have a hard time finding an alternative in the same bracket and pricepoint.

Other notes: try to keep the battery charged as much as possible. No spare tire so runflats prescribed, try to make sure you have a support line (tyre stockist) in case they get punctured beyond repair.
